Will We See Our Rookies On The Floor In The 2nd Half Of The Season?

Now that we have Andre Miller, a veteran PG who can definitely run the P&R and should really have no problem running our system since it's so P&R heavy. Shall we see more of our rookies in the 2nd half of the season. Our starters are firmly in place & Witt has his 9 man rotation ( starters, plus Book, Kev, Webster & now Miller in place of Temple) in place. Will he stretch it to accommodate the Rooks. I figure he won't stretch it to more than 11 and certainly Harrington has a spot on hold for him. Rather he replaces Booker or just is added on. But I feel what we need for our 2nd unit is floor spacing, Rice & Porter (if he regains his shooting form) can do that, manning down the other wing with Webster. I like Temple's defense & he should be thrown in as a defensive specialist in certain situations. But since our offense is so PG initiated off the P&R, I feel we need more catch & shoot guys on the floor as possible. Miller can draw the same attention as Wall for our 2nd unit since he's so crafty. Maybe even Wall will get pulled out earlier in the 1st to run the 2nd unit.

But, either way will Otto or Rice get more time. Temple got us in our sets, but didn't draw that much attention. Webster & Porter suffered a little in my opinion as the defense stayed home more. Even when Beal was added to the unit to give it more punch. The defense basically played him the same way, which resulted in his long two's. But with Miller, defenses could cheat off our wings more giving them better looks at the rim. If the defenses stay home Miller is crafty enough to get all the way to the rim unlike the former. So this could open up a spot for the Rooks to battle it out for that other wing spot to help stretch the floor.

I feel you can never have too many shooters on the roster. Beal, Ariza & Webster all go through slumps, so why not get Rice & Porter some minutes out there when they do. I know this rotation issue should of been hashed out in the first half of the season, but we worked with what we had. Now that Miller is here and almost every team in the East playoff hunt made moves, all of us will be still experimenting in the 2nd half. So it wouldn't be far fetched to give these Rooks more time, especially Rice Jr. whose shooting wasn't that bad as Porter's, although I would like to see both of them out there in the 2nd half of the season.
